Temperature Scale Comparison
| Description | Celsius (°C) | Fahrenheit (°F) | Kelvin (K) |
|---|---|---|---|
| Absolute Zero | -273.15 | -459.67 | 0 |
| Freezing Point of Water | 0 | 32 | 273.15 |
| Room Temperature | 20 to 25 | 68 to 77 | 293.15 to 298.15 |
| Body Temperature | 37 | 98.6 | 310.15 |
| Boiling Point of Water | 100 | 212 | 373.15 |
About Temperature Units
Temperature is a physical quantity that expresses hot and cold. It is measured with a thermometer calibrated in one or more temperature scales.
Celsius (°C)
The Celsius scale, also known as the centigrade scale, is a temperature scale used by the International System of Units (SI). It is defined so that 0°C is the freezing point of water and 100°C is the boiling point of water at standard atmospheric pressure.
Fahrenheit (°F)
The Fahrenheit scale is a temperature scale based on one proposed in 1724 by the physicist Daniel Gabriel Fahrenheit. On the Fahrenheit scale, the freezing point of water is 32°F and the boiling point is 212°F at standard atmospheric pressure.
Kelvin (K)
The Kelvin scale is an absolute temperature scale used in scientific work. Zero on the Kelvin scale is absolute zero, the theoretical point at which all thermal motion ceases. The Kelvin scale is used extensively in scientific work because a number of physical quantities, such as the volume of an ideal gas, are directly related to absolute temperature.
Rankine (°R)
The Rankine scale is an absolute temperature scale named after the Scottish engineer and physicist William John Macquorn Rankine, who proposed it in 1859. The symbol is °R. Zero on the Rankine scale is absolute zero, and a temperature difference of 1°R is equal to a temperature difference of 1°F.
Conversion Formulas
- Celsius to Fahrenheit: °F = (°C × 9/5) + 32
- Fahrenheit to Celsius: °C = (°F - 32) × 5/9
- Celsius to Kelvin: K = °C + 273.15
- Kelvin to Celsius: °C = K - 273.15
- Fahrenheit to Kelvin: K = (°F + 459.67) × 5/9
- Kelvin to Fahrenheit: °F = (K × 9/5) - 459.67
- Fahrenheit to Rankine: °R = °F + 459.67
- Rankine to Fahrenheit: °F = °R - 459.67
- Kelvin to Rankine: °R = K × 9/5
- Rankine to Kelvin: K = °R × 5/9
